        "text": "A typical **full kitchen remodel in Los Angeles County usually ranges from about $25,000 to $120,000+**, depending on size, layout changes, and finish level. Smaller ‘pull-and-replace’ projects can fall near the low end, while structural changes and high-end finishes drive costs up.\n\nCosts in LA are higher than many other cities due to labor rates, permit requirements, and material pricing. Think in ranges, not exact numbers, until you’ve finalized the design and scope.\n\nKey factors:\n- Size of the kitchen and whether walls or plumbing are moved\n- Cabinet type (stock, semi-custom, custom) and countertop materials\n- Appliance package, lighting, and ventilation upgrades\n- Condition of existing electrical, plumbing, and framing\n\nStart by defining a total budget and a 10–15% contingency, then share that with your contractor so the design stays realistic. Ask for a detailed line-item estimate so you can see where money is going and what you can adjust. A reputable contractor will help you value-engineer the project without compromising safety.\n\nA thoughtful budget conversation early on usually leads to a more satisfying result and fewer mid-project surprises."
